Sonny's obituary
Sonny Showen passed peacefully in his sleep in his Fort Wayne, IN home on April 28th, 2022, after 74 Years, 5 Months and 27 Days of life on this earth. Sonny was born to Kenneth & Donna Showen on October 25th, 1947, in Marion, IN.
Sonny attended Marion High School, enlisted in the Army in 1965, and served with the 101st Airborne Division at Fort Campbell, KY. During his time in Kentucky, Sonny would become a father to Kenneth (Kevin) R Showen III and Kris Showen (Fran). After coming back home to Indiana, Sonny opened a pool hall in Marion where relatives and a host of locals would shoot pool and play pinball. Over the next several years, Sonny would bounce between Marion and Fort Wayne where he would father two more children, Sean Goins & Sarah Goins (Joyce). In the late 80’s Sonny would eventually settle down with his wife of nearly 30 Years, Betty, where he spent the majority of his career in the automobile dealership industry.
Sonny enjoyed playing guitar & harmonica and partook in many backyard or living room jam sessions with his Brothers, Cousins, and friends. He was also an avid Bass Angler that liked to tell tall tales about this “big one” that got away. Sonny really took pleasure in camping because he could blend these two by fishing during the day and jamming around the campfire at night. From November until March of every year, Sonny would root on his beloved IU Hoosiers. In his later years, due to not being able to physically play the guitar any longer, he really enjoyed collecting & selling sheet music and other memorabilia at auction.
After a tough last 10 years with severe neck and spine pain, Sonny was confident he would be welcomed home pain free by his Creator, Father and Lord, Jesus Christ!
